The Return of Warm Wood Tones


For several years, white and gray cooking areas dominated design patterns, offering a clean and sophisticated visual. While these combinations still have their location, homeowners are gravitating toward rich, warm wood tones that bring depth and character back into the kitchen area. Kitchen cabinetry in walnut, cherry, and oak is gaining back popularity, including an organic and ageless feel to the room. These natural elements develop a feeling of heat that contrasts beautifully with modern devices and components, making the kitchen area really feel inviting and lived-in.


Classic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ship


Shaker-style cupboards, beadboard details, and complex moldings are resurfacing as preferred options in kitchen restorations. Property owners appreciate the workmanship and personality that typical cupboard styles provide. The simplicity of shaker cupboards makes them flexible, matching well with both contemporary and vintage-inspired decor. Glass-front cupboards are likewise seeing a revival, supplying a classy means to display valued crockery and glass wares while including an open, ventilated feeling to the cooking area.


Vintage-Inspired Backsplashes That Steal the Show


Backsplashes have actually constantly played a considerable function in kitchen design, and currently, they're ending up being a centerpiece once again. Classic train ceramic tiles, particularly in somewhat uneven or handcrafted variations, bring a touch of quaint charm while keeping a classic allure. Formed ceramic tiles, similar to European kitchens, are one more popular selection. These layouts add personality and a feeling of creativity, changing an ordinary cooking area wall surface into a striking attribute.


Reviving the Butcher Block Countertop


While rock countertops like quartz and granite have been preferred for their resilience, many homeowners are discovering the beauty and capability of butcher block kitchen counters. The warmth of timber kitchen counters not just boosts a classic kitchen visual but likewise gives a functional surface area for meal preparation. Whether used as a full countertop or as an accent on a kitchen area island, butcher block surfaces bring a feeling of rustic appeal and functionality to any type of space.


Statement Lighting with a Nostalgic Twist


Lights is necessary in developing ambiance, and vintage-inspired fixtures are taking center stage in classic kitchen designs. Necklace lights with aged brass, functioned iron, or glass shades evocative early 20th-century designs are making a comeback. Large components and industrial-style illumination include character and enhance the timeless appearance. Whether you prefer a cozy, dim glow or brilliant task lighting, the appropriate fixtures can enhance the overall visual while enhancing capability.


The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ets


Few aspects evoke classic kitchen design quite like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not only visually appealing however additionally very useful, fitting large pots and pans with ease. Paired with bridge taps, which include an ageless, exposed-plumbing look, these sinks contribute to the old-world charm that so many homeowners are craving. The mix of these components blends history with modern-day ease, making them a must-have for any individual looking to revive a classic kitchen visual.


Vintage-Inspired Appliances: Modern Functionality Meets Nostalgic Appeal


While stainless steel devices stay a staple in modern kitchen areas, many homeowners are attracted to vintage-inspired designs that blend effortlessly with timeless decoration. Retro-style fridges, ovens with traditional handles and dials, and range hoods with elaborate describing include an one-of-a-kind charm to the area. These home appliances offer modern-day efficiency while preserving the aesthetic appeal of lost eras, permitting home owners to delight in the very best of both globes.


Cozy and Inviting Kitchen Dining Areas


The principle of an eat-in cooking area is returning as home owners welcome the heat of shared dishes and informal gatherings. Breakfast nooks with built-in seats, farmhouse tables, and upholstered chairs create a comfortable and inviting environment. Whether it's a traditional wood table or a vintage-inspired banquette, these rooms motivate connection and comfort, strengthening the idea of the cooking area as the heart of the home.


Attractive Accents That Tell a Story


The appeal of traditional kitchen areas lies in the details. Ornamental aspects such as open shelving with very carefully curated crockery, antique-inspired hardware, and handmade fabrics contribute to a nostalgic, tailored touch. Mixing contemporary conveniences with ageless style enables an equilibrium of feature and aesthetic, guaranteeing that the area continues to be both useful and aesthetically attractive.
